Abstract

The invention discloses a method and a device for identifying an image, and relates to the technical field of computers. One embodiment of the method comprises: acquiring a focal length parameter; and adjusting the focal length of the image acquisition equipment based on the focal length parameter, and after each adjustment, identifying the current image acquired by the image acquisition equipment until the image content is successfully identified. The embodiment can complete the recognition of the image without complete focusing, and can improve the recognition efficiency to a certain extent.

Background
The bar code (one-dimensional code, two-dimensional code and the like) is used as a tool for bearing information, has the advantages of strong universality, easiness in generation and identification and the like, and is an important information interaction means. In the existing barcode identification technology, focusing of an image to be identified is completed by a camera, and then a barcode in a current image acquired by the camera is identified.
In the process of implementing the invention, the inventor finds that at least the following problems exist in the prior art: the image needs to be identified after the focusing is completely finished, so that the times of focal length adjustment are increased; the focus adjustment range is a fixed value, each focusing needs to consume a long time, and a large amount of time is wasted in a high-frequency use scene.

Detailed Description
Exemplary embodiments of the present invention are described below with reference to the accompanying drawings, in which various details of embodiments of the invention are included to assist understanding, and which are to be considered as merely exemplary. Accordingly, those of ordinary skill in the art will recognize that various changes and modifications of the embodiments described herein can be made without departing from the scope and spirit of the invention. Also, descriptions of well-known functions and constructions are omitted in the following description for clarity and conciseness.
Fig. 1 is a schematic diagram of main steps of a method of recognizing an image according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in fig. 1, a method for recognizing an image according to an embodiment of the present invention includes:
and S101, acquiring a focal length parameter. The focal length parameter in the embodiment is not a default value, but a statistical value obtained by collecting the focal length value of each user when the user successfully identifies the image in the past and calculating, so that compared with the default value, the focal length parameter in the invention can be closer to the focal length in the scene commonly used by the user, thereby reducing the time consumed by focusing. The statistical value can be a fixed value obtained by calculation according to focal length data obtained in advance when the image is successfully identified in a specific use scene; in addition, the focal length parameter may be a value updated in real time according to the acquired data during the use process of the user, and the calculation method will be described in the following embodiments.
S102, adjusting the focal length of the image acquisition equipment based on the focal length parameter, and after each adjustment, identifying the current image acquired by the image acquisition equipment until the image content is successfully identified. The image acquisition equipment mainly refers to a camera lens and can also be equipment with other adjustable focal lengths and used for acquiring images.
For image recognition technology, it is not necessary that full focusing is successful to recognize the content of an image; for example, for barcode identification, as long as the width of each barcode can be distinguished, the information contained in the barcode can be identified, and a cleaned barcode profile does not need to be acquired; for example, for color recognition, it is not necessary to acquire a clear image, and each color patch may be distinguished. The present embodiment applies the above principle, and identifies the acquired current image after adjusting the focal length each time until the identification is successful. Thus, the number of times of focal length adjustment can be effectively reduced, thereby shortening the overall time consumption of image recognition.
Fig. 2 is a schematic diagram of main steps of a method of recognizing an image according to another embodiment of the present invention.
As shown, in some optional embodiments, the focus parameter includes an initial focus value and an end focus value; the method for recognizing the image comprises the following steps:
s201, acquiring an initial focal length value and a final focal length value. The initial focal length value is the first focal length used when the image acquisition equipment acquires the image, and the final focal length value is the last focal length used when the image acquisition equipment acquires the image; both defining the focus adjustment range of the image acquisition device.
S202, setting the current focal length of the image acquisition equipment as an initial focal length value.
S203, identifying the current image acquired by the image acquisition equipment. If the current image is not successfully identified, go to step S204; if the current image is successfully identified, go to step S205.
S204, superposing a change quantity on the current focal length of the image acquisition equipment so as to enable the current focal length value to tend to change towards the termination focal length value; go to step S203.
It should be noted that the initial focal length value may be a smaller value or a larger value relative to the end focal length value, and when the initial focal length value is a smaller value, the change amount is a positive number, otherwise, the change amount is a negative number. The magnitude of the change determines the time consumption and the precision of the focal length adjustment, and can be determined according to a specific use scene to obtain the balance between the speed and the precision. In contrast, since full focusing is not required, the amount of change may be slightly larger than the default value of the single focus change amount of the image pickup device when adjusting the focus.
And S205, completing image recognition.
Specifically, the initial focal length value and the final focal length value in the present embodiment are generated by the following steps:
recording the current focal length when the user successfully identifies the image content as a sample focal length value;
selecting the minimum value from the sample focal length values as the minimum focal length value of the user, and selecting the maximum value as the maximum focal length value of the user;
and acquiring minimum focal length values and maximum focal length values of a plurality of users, taking the median of each minimum focal length value as an initial focal length value, and taking the median of each maximum focal length value as a termination focal length value. It should be noted that, the minimum focal length value may also be used as the end focal length value, and the maximum focal length value may also be used as the initial focal length value, at which time the positive or negative of the change amount should be adaptively adjusted.
In addition, it should be understood that the selected users in this embodiment should have the same or similar usage scenarios. For example, the focal lengths of the users in the daily use environment or the staff in the same position on the production line are different from each other less when the users successfully recognize the image, so that a smaller focal length adjustment range can be defined to improve the efficiency of image recognition.
Fig. 3 is a schematic diagram of main steps of a method of recognizing an image according to still another embodiment of the present invention.
In the former embodiment, when determining the initial and final focal length values, the user who needs to provide the sample data is in the same or similar usage scenario, which limits the application scope of the embodiment to some extent. As an improvement, the focal length parameter in this embodiment further includes scene identifiers, and each scene identifier corresponds to a set of initial focal length value and end focal length value respectively; as shown in fig. 3, the present embodiment includes:
s301, determining a current scene identifier according to a current using scene of the image acquisition device, and acquiring an initial focal length value and a final focal length value corresponding to the current scene identifier.
And S302, setting the current focal length of the image acquisition equipment as an initial focal length value.
S303, identifying the current image acquired by the image acquisition equipment. If the current image is not successfully identified, go to step S304; if the current image is successfully identified, go to step S305.
S304, superposing a change quantity on the current focal length of the image acquisition equipment so as to enable the current focal length value to tend to change towards the termination focal length value; go to step S303.
S305, completing the image recognition.
Specifically, the initial focal length value and the final focal length value in the present embodiment are generated by the following steps:
recording the current focal length when the user successfully identifies the image content as a sample focal length value, and determining a scene identifier of the sample focal length value according to a use scene when the user successfully identifies the image content;
classifying the focal length values of the samples according to the scene identifications, respectively selecting a minimum value from all the categories as a minimum focal length value of the user corresponding to each scene identification, and selecting a maximum value from all the categories as a maximum focal length value of the user corresponding to each scene identification;
the minimum focal length value and the maximum focal length value of each scene identification corresponding to a plurality of users are obtained, the median of each minimum focal length value corresponding to the scene identification is used as the initial focal length value corresponding to the scene identification, and the median of each maximum focal length value corresponding to the scene identification is used as the final focal length value corresponding to the scene identification.
The scene identifier is used for marking a use scene of a user, for example, a user in a certain preset area can be divided into a specific scene identifier by a way of defining a coordinate range; or, according to the image recognition task currently performed by the user, dividing the user performing the same or similar image recognition task into a specific scene identifier. Compared with the previous embodiment, the method can further refine the statistical ranges of the initial focal length value and the final focal length value according to the use scenes of the user, so that the adaptability of the method to different use scenes is improved, and the application range of the method is expanded.
